Overview
We are seeking a compassionate and skilled Family Therapist to join our team. The ideal candidate will possess a strong background in psychotherapy and behavioral health, with a focus on providing support and guidance to families facing various challenges. This role requires a commitment to patient care, effective case management, and the ability to conduct diagnostic evaluations in accordance with HIPAA regulations. As a Family Therapist, you will play a vital role in helping families navigate their issues while fostering a supportive and healing environment.
Responsibilities
- Conduct individual and family therapy sessions to address emotional and psychological issues.
- Develop and implement treatment plans tailored to the specific needs of each family.
- Perform diagnostic evaluations to assess mental health conditions and recommend appropriate interventions.
- Provide case management services, ensuring that clients receive comprehensive support throughout their treatment journey.
- Maintain accurate and confidential patient records in compliance with HIPAA regulations.
- Collaborate with other healthcare professionals, including psychiatrists and social workers, to coordinate care for patients.
- Engage in clinical research as needed to enhance therapeutic practices and outcomes.
- Utilize knowledge of ICD-9 coding for proper documentation of diagnoses.
Qualifications
- Master’s degree in Social Work, Counseling, Psychology, or a related field.
- Valid state licensure as a Licensed Professional Counselor (LPC), Licensed Clinical Social Worker (LCSW), or equivalent.
- Proven experience in psychotherapy, particularly within family therapy settings.
- Familiarity with Christian counseling principles is preferred but not required.
- Strong understanding of behavioral health practices and case management techniques.
-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written, with the ability to build rapport with clients.
- Ability to work collaboratively within a multidisciplinary team environment.
- Commitment to maintaining confidentiality and adhering to ethical standards in patient care.
